2000+

Tools

50K+

Active Users

1M+

Files Processed

99.9%

Uptime

CloudAIRambo LogoCloudAIRambo

All-in-one tool hub for file conversion, editors, and developer utilities.

Company

Legal

Get Started

Ready to boost your productivity? Explore our tools today.

© 2026 CloudAIRambo. All rights reserved.

Support: [email protected] | Abuse: [email protected] | Security: [email protected] | Legal: [email protected]

Free XML to CSV Converter — Parse & Export XML Data into Spreadsheets Online

Convert complex XML files into clean, flat CSV spreadsheets instantly in your browser — nested tags intelligently flattened, attributes preserved as columns, ready to open in Excel, Google Sheets, or any data pipeline. No coding, no sign-up, no server uploads.

Upload XML

Convert XML to CSV Online – Free XML to CSV Converter

The XML to CSV converter is a fast and reliable tool that allows you to convert XML to CSV online quickly and efficiently. XML (Extensible Markup Language) is widely used to store structured and hierarchical data for APIs, web services, and data exchange, but it can be difficult to read and analyze in spreadsheet tools.

By converting XML files into CSV format, you can flatten structured data into rows and columns, making it easy to work with in Microsoft Excel, Google Sheets, LibreOffice Calc, and data analysis tools. CSV files are lightweight and ideal for data processing, reporting, and integration.

This free XML to CSV converter online works directly in your browser with no installation required. Upload your XML file, convert it instantly, and download a CSV file ready for analysis, sharing, or database import.

How to Convert XML to CSV Online

  1. Click the Upload XML File button.
  2. Select your XML file from your device.
  3. Click Convert to CSV to start processing.
  4. Wait a few seconds while the data is converted.
  5. Download your CSV file.

Our XML to CSV converter online free extracts structured elements and converts them into clean, comma-separated rows for easy use in spreadsheets.

XML vs CSV – Key Differences

FeatureXMLCSV
StructureHierarchical (nested tags)Flat (rows and columns)
ReadabilityComplexSimple and readable
File SizeLargerSmaller
Use CaseData storage and APIsData analysis and spreadsheets
ProcessingRequires parsing logicEasy to process

Converting XML to CSV simplifies complex hierarchical data into a format that is easy to analyze and manipulate.

Benefits of Converting XML to CSV

Spreadsheet Compatibility

Open CSV files easily in Excel, Google Sheets, and other spreadsheet tools.

Better Data Analysis

Sort, filter, and analyze structured data efficiently in tabular format.

Lightweight Format

CSV files are smaller and faster to process compared to XML files.

Easy Data Sharing

Share CSV files easily across platforms and applications.

Data Integration

Import CSV data into databases, analytics tools, and applications.

Automation Friendly

Use CSV files in scripts, ETL pipelines, and automation workflows.

XML to CSV Converter Features & Use Cases

Our XML to CSV converter free is designed for developers, analysts, and data engineers who need to transform structured data quickly and accurately. It ensures clean output suitable for spreadsheets and data processing tools.

FeatureDescription
Fast ConversionConvert XML files within seconds
Accurate Data MappingPreserves key data fields during conversion
Clean CSV OutputGenerates structured rows and columns
Browser-Based ToolNo installation required
Secure ProcessingFiles are handled safely

Common Use Cases

  • Convert XML data for Excel and spreadsheet analysis
  • Prepare data for database import
  • Transform API responses into CSV datasets
  • Use CSV files in ETL and data pipelines
  • Simplify structured data for reporting and visualization

This XML to CSV converter online is ideal for developers, analysts, and data professionals who want to convert structured XML data into a simple, usable format quickly and efficiently.

XML to CSV Converter FAQ

What is an XML file?

XML (eXtensible Markup Language) is a structured data format used for storing and transporting data in applications and APIs.

What is a CSV file?

CSV (Comma-Separated Values) is a plain text format used to store tabular data in rows and columns.

Why convert XML to CSV?

CSV simplifies structured XML data into a flat table format for easy viewing, editing, and analysis.

Can I convert XML to CSV online?

Yes, upload your XML file and convert it to CSV instantly without installing software.

Is this XML to CSV converter free?

Yes, the tool is completely free and requires no registration.

How is XML data mapped to CSV?

XML elements are converted into rows and columns, with tags mapped to column headers.

Can complex XML structures be converted?

Yes, but deeply nested XML may be flattened or require transformation rules.

Will attributes be preserved?

Yes, XML attributes are typically converted into CSV columns.

Are my files secure during conversion?

Yes, files are encrypted and automatically deleted after processing.

Can I convert large XML files?

Yes, large files are supported depending on tool limits.

Can I batch convert multiple XML files?

Yes, many tools support bulk conversion.

Does CSV support nested data?

No, CSV is a flat format and does not support nested structures.

What happens to nested XML elements?

Nested elements are flattened into columns or separated into multiple rows.

Can I customize column mapping?

Yes, advanced tools allow mapping XML tags to specific CSV columns.

What delimiter is used in CSV?

Comma is standard, but semicolons or tabs can also be used.

Does conversion affect data accuracy?

No, values are preserved accurately during conversion.

Can I convert XML from APIs?

Yes, API XML responses can be converted to CSV.

Does CSV support special characters?

Yes, proper encoding like UTF-8 ensures correct character handling.

Can I convert CSV back to XML?

Yes, reverse conversion is possible using CSV to XML tools.

Which browsers support XML to CSV conversion?

Chrome, Firefox, Edge, and Safari all support online converters.

Is internet required for conversion?

Yes, online tools require an internet connection.

Can I use this tool on mobile devices?

Yes, it works on smartphones and tablets.

What is XML schema (XSD)?

XSD defines the structure and data types of XML documents.

Does CSV support data types?

CSV stores plain text, but applications may interpret data types.

Can I preview CSV output before downloading?

Yes, many tools provide preview functionality.

Is XML to CSV conversion fast?

Yes, most conversions complete within seconds.

Can I convert XML for Excel use?

Yes, CSV files can be opened directly in Excel.

What is the difference between XML and CSV?

XML is hierarchical and structured, while CSV is flat and simple.

Can I clean XML data before conversion?

Yes, preprocessing XML improves output quality.

Who should use XML to CSV conversion?

Developers, analysts, and anyone working with structured data and spreadsheets.

Related Data Conversion Tools